Placement Of Cat Food And Litter Box. There should be at least a few rooms’ distance between the bowl of food and the litter box so that your cat will not feel bothered about the placement of the litter box. The optimal distance between your cat’s food and litter box is at least 10 feet. Keep litter boxes away from eating and sleeping areas. Try to find a quiet, separate area of your home to place the litter box, even if it is a small distance away from your cat’s food. Obviously, you do not want a litter box in the middle of your living room or in the kitchen next to the cat's food dishes, so where do you put it? Because cats are such clean creatures by nature, they consider having their essential resources next to where they poop or pee unhygienic, devoss explains. Ideally, the food and litter box should be placed in separate rooms, or at least on opposite sides of the same room. Cats like privacy when they eliminate, not because of modesty, but because of a primal fear of being ambushed by an enemy when their guard is down.
